View Single Post
Old July 25 2007, 03:18 AM   #97
Vice Admiral
TorontoTrekker's Avatar
Location: Toronto, Ontario, Canada
Re: YouTube Videos

It's finally been posted - the TT-versus-Polaris blooper reel! (Yes, I know I laugh like a spaz. After watching this, I may never dare to laugh again. )

This is the last TT-versus-Polaris post - for this year, anyway. Who knows if we'll do them again next year.
TorontoTrekker is offline   Reply With Quote